GEP's Selection for Port of Tanjung Pelepas
The Port of Tanjung Pelepas (PTP) has recently opted for GEP's innovative AI-driven contract lifecycle management (CLM) solution. This strategic move aims to bolster its operational objectives related to governance, compliance, and overall scalability. Recognized as Malaysia's leading transshipment hub, PTP is among the busiest container ports globally, and this implementation will significantly enhance their contract management processes.

Growth Metrics Highlighting PTP's Performance
Currently, PTP is recognized as the fastest-growing port globally, achieving an impressive 15.4% growth rate during the first half of the year. This remarkable performance has garnered attention from industry analysts and underscores PTP's commitment to efficient operations and strategic partnerships. The selection of GEP SOFTWARE comes at a crucial time, as the port prepares for increased demand and expanded capacities.
Future Implementation Plans
The deployment of the GEP CLM solution is targeted to go live in February 2026. With this strategic timeline, PTP expects to increasingly enhance its operational frameworks, aligning with its trajectory towards remarkable growth and advanced compliance protocols.
